The `context-only` option causes `sloglint` to report the use of methods without a context:

```go
slog.Info("a user has logged in") // sloglint: methods without a context should not be used
slog.Info("a user has logged in") // sloglint: InfoContext should be used instead
```

This report can be fixed by using the equivalent method with the `Context` suffix:

```go
slog.InfoContext(ctx, "a user has logged in")
```
Possible values are `all` (report all contextless calls) and `scope` (report only if a context exists in the scope of the outermost function).

func hasContextInScope(info *types.Info, stack []ast.Node) bool {
for i := len(stack) - 1; i >= 0; i-- {
decl, ok := stack[i].(*ast.FuncDecl)
if !ok {
continue
}
params := decl.Type.Params
if len(params.List) == 0 || len(params.List[0].Names) == 0 {
continue
}
typ := info.TypeOf(params.List[0].Names[0])
if typ != nil && typ.String() == "context.Context" {
return true
}
}
return false
}
